Course Content

• Water-wise Turfgrass Management for Athletic Fields
• Irrigation System Auditing and Optimization for Water Conservation
• Soil Health and Water Infiltration Enhancement Techniques
• Drought-Tolerant Turfgrass Selection and Establishment
• Water Conservation Technologies and Best Practices for Athletic Fields
• Integrated Pest Management (IPM) for Sustainable Turfgrass
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Water Use Efficiency
• Water Budgeting and Allocation Strategies for Sports Grounds
• Policy and Regulations related to Water Conservation in Sports
• Sustainable Drainage Systems (SuDS) for Athletic Fields

Career path

Career Role (Water Conservation Best Practices) Description
Water Conservation Officer (Athletic Fields) Develops and implements water-efficient irrigation strategies for sports grounds, ensuring optimal turf health while minimizing water usage. Industry-leading expertise in water auditing and management.
Sports Turf Manager (Water Wise) Manages the maintenance of athletic fields, prioritizing sustainable water practices. Focus on soil health, drought-resistant turf varieties, and advanced irrigation technologies.
Irrigation Specialist (Athletic Grounds) Specializes in designing, installing, and maintaining efficient irrigation systems for athletic facilities. Expert in smart irrigation technologies and water-saving techniques.
Landscape Architect (Water Sensitive Design) Designs athletic field landscapes that incorporate sustainable water management practices. Experience in creating drought-tolerant environments and minimizing water consumption.
